history

The Buffalo Buccaneers first started as the Lancaster Buccaneers playing in the Western New York Christian Football League back in 1998.  The team name changed in 2001 to the Buffalo Buccaneers, in order to become better recognized in national tournaments.  The Buc's continuously travel among tournaments sponsored by the United States Flag and Touch League (USFTL) around the nation. The Buc's are currently in the "B" division ranks, after winning the "C" division national championship in 2005.  The Buc's make weekend trips throughout the year to cities such as Cleveland, Pittsburgh, Columbus, Baltimore, Detroit, and Orlando, FL.  A special thanks goes out to every sponsor that has helped us along the way.
